DOD Announcements
Apr 2023:
SOL Engineering Services LLC,* Vicksburg, Mississippi, was awarded a $24,900,000 firm-fixed-price contract to provide subject matter expertise to the Department of Defense High Performance Computing Modernization Program. Bids were solicited via the internet with two received. Work locations and funding will be determined with each order, with an estimated completion date of April 4, 2028. U.S. Army Corps of Engineers' Engineer Research and Development Center, Vicksburg, Mississippi, is the contracting activity (W912HZ-23-D-0004).
